## Artifact Signing for Nightbatch

Hey, new folks! Nightbatch is our scheduler that kicks off data backfills every night around 1am. Because backfill jobs can rewrite historical tables, we're strict about provenance: every Nightbatch artifact gets signed before the orchestrator will touch it. The flow is simple — build, sign, push, and the verifier checks the signature at pickup time. If verification fails, the backfill just skips and pages on-call. To sign locally, configure your tooling with the team key shown here.

deploy key for kajof-fajop: bky6_gDHw9Q

Subject: Welcome aboard — cron drift on Hollowmere

Hi, and welcome to the rotation. Quick context before your first shift: we've been chasing drift in the Hollowmere cron fleet where scheduled jobs slip by up to four minutes, which matters to you because it skews our audit log ordering. We suspect the NTP fallback path, but nothing's confirmed. Don't restart the schedulers without logging it — chain of custody matters here. The investigation notes, packet captures, and current hypotheses are collected on the internal tracking page.

wiki page, tahaf-tajog: https://jira.ordindyn.corp/pipeline

Runbook 7.2 — Greenhouse controller sensor drift. If humidity readings on the Plumvale units diverge by more than 4%, trigger recalibration via the drift-correction service before cutting the release. The service reads its config from the controller env file; its authentication value belongs on the line directly after this sentence.

env line for fafof-fahag: LEDGER_TOKEN5=f8790